OverviewJessica Morgan is a gifted profiler. Some might even use the term legendary when speaking of her skills. So much so that the FBI Director takes it upon himself to call her back into service years after a personal tragedy caused her to walk away from the Bureau. Returning with her profiling skills intact and a medical degree, Agent Morgan's task is to assess the investigation she's assigned, profile the UNSUB (unknown subject), and deliver the profile to the investigating agents before moving on to the next case. She works tirelessly, relentlessly, and most importantly...alone. Until now. The Director pairs Jessica with Dr. Erin Little, a skilled forensic pathologist and an outstanding FBI agent. Erin has earned a favorable reputation during her ten years at the Bureau. Erin's task force, assigned to find a serial killer dubbed The Slasher by the newspapers, continues to hit dead ends, prompting the Director to ignore Jessica's rule of working alone. He puts them together, knowing their combined skills are needed to catch The Slasher and bring him to justice. As sparks fly professionally and personally, Jessica and Erin race against time to stop the serial killer before he strikes again.
